Three suspects arrested in connection with Shooting in Fells Point

BALTIMORE, MARYLAND – On January 15, 2022, at approximately 1:04 a.m., Southeast District patrol officers were dispatched to the 1700 block of Thames Street to investigate a reported shooting.

When officers arrived at the location they observed an adult male suffering from apparent gunshot wounds. The victim was transported to an area hospital with non-life threatening injuries.

Southeast District Shooting investigators responded to the scene and assumed control over the investigation. Detectives spoke with witnesses and learned that the shooting occurred after a physical altercation erupted inside of a local establishment. According to witnesses, after exiting the establishment the suspects got into a SUV and shot the victim from the vehicle.

Through the course of their investigation, detectives were able to identify the suspects involved. On February 2, 2022, 25-year-old Nathan Presbury of Belcamp, Md., 26-year-old Luciano Bruno of Cecilton, Md. and 31-year-old Ronald Maranto of a Perryville, Md. were arrested and criminally charged with the Fells Point shooting.

Presbury, Luciano and Maranto are currently being held without bail pending trial. Charges range from 1st Degree Attempted Murder to conspiracy to commit murder, as well as other offenses related to the crime.
